About Glidden Pacific Pearl

Pacific Pearl is very light — LRV 82, close to white. It opens up small or dim rooms and keeps walls feeling airy. Its green und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. In north light it can read slightly cooler; a warm white trim alongside keeps it from going clinical.

Pacific Pearl shines on ceilings, trim and in small or low-light rooms where you need to stretch the light — and as a calm whole-home backdrop. As a white, it's a natural for trim, ceilings and cabinets, and a clean backdrop for art.
